Common AI Myths and the Real Facts About AI

Artificial Intelligence (AI) is growing very fast in today’s world. We use AI in mobile phones, social media, online shopping, banking, hospitals, and even in schools. Because AI is becoming popular, many people have different ideas and fears about it. Some of these ideas are true, but many are only myths. Understanding the truth about AI is very important because it helps people use technology wisely.
This article explains some common myths about AI and the real facts behind them.
Myth 1: AI Will Completely Replace Humans
Many people think AI will take all human jobs and humans will become useless.
Fact:
AI can automate some tasks, but it cannot fully replace humans. AI works based on data and instructions. Humans still need creativity, emotions, critical thinking, leadership, and decision-making skills. For example, AI can help doctors analyze reports, but it cannot fully replace a doctor’s experience and care for patients.
AI usually helps humans work faster and better instead of replacing them completely.
Myth 2: AI Can Think Like Humans
Some people believe AI has feelings, emotions, and human intelligence.
Fact:
AI does not think like humans. AI only follows patterns and instructions from data. It does not have emotions, consciousness, or personal opinions. When AI gives answers, it is based on training data and algorithms, not real understanding.
Humans can feel happiness, sadness, love, and fear. AI cannot experience these emotions.
Myth 3: AI Is Always Correct
People often trust AI systems completely and think they never make mistakes.
Fact:
AI can also make errors. AI systems depend on the quality of data they are trained on. If the data is wrong, incomplete, or biased, the AI can produce incorrect results.
For example, a face recognition system may sometimes identify the wrong person. This is why human supervision is still important when using AI systems.
Myth 4: AI Is Only for Big Companies
Many believe only large technology companies can use AI.
Fact:
Today, AI tools are available for everyone. Students, small businesses, teachers, and content creators can also use AI. Many free AI tools help people write articles, create images, learn coding, translate languages, and improve productivity.
AI technology is becoming more affordable and accessible every year.
Myth 5: AI Is Dangerous for Humanity
Movies often show AI robots destroying the world, which creates fear among people.
Fact:
AI itself is not dangerous. The real issue depends on how humans use it. AI can be used for both good and bad purposes, just like any other technology.
For example:
* AI can help doctors detect diseases early.
* AI can improve online education.
* AI can also be misused for fake videos or cyber attacks.
The responsibility is on humans to use AI ethically and safely.
Myth 6: AI Can Learn Without Human Help
Some people think AI becomes intelligent completely on its own.
Fact:
AI needs human-created data, training, and programming. Humans design the models, provide information, and improve the systems. Without human input, AI cannot function properly.
Even advanced AI systems need regular updates and monitoring from experts.
Myth 7: AI and Robots Are the Same
Many people think AI always means robots.
Fact:
AI and robots are different things. AI is software or intelligence that performs tasks using data. Robots are physical machines. Some robots use AI, but many AI systems exist without robots.
For example:
* Voice assistants use AI but are not robots.
* Self-driving cars use AI software.
* A factory robot may work without advanced AI.
Myth 8: AI Is Only for Technology Experts
People sometimes believe AI is too difficult for normal users.
Fact:
Anyone can learn basic AI concepts. Many websites, apps, and online courses teach AI in simple ways. Students and beginners can start learning AI without being experts in programming.
Today, AI is becoming part of daily life, so learning basic AI knowledge is useful for everyone
The Importance of Understanding AI Correctly
Believing false information about AI can create fear and confusion. Understanding the real facts helps people:
* Use AI responsibly
* Learn new skills
* Improve productivity
* Make better career decisions
* Avoid unnecessary fear
AI is a tool created by humans. It can help society in healthcare, education, business, agriculture, and many other fields when used properly.

Conclusion
AI is one of the most powerful technologies in the modern world. However, many myths about AI create misunderstanding among people. AI cannot fully replace humans, think like humans, or work perfectly without mistakes. It is simply a technology designed to assist humans in solving problems and improving efficiency.
Instead of fearing AI, people should learn about it and understand its real capabilities and limitations. The future of AI depends not only on technology but also on how humans choose to use it responsibly and ethically.
